รวมและแยกเอกสารด้วย PHP SDK

Cloud REST API สำหรับนักพัฒนาสามารถรวมหรือแยกเอกสารหลายฉบับที่มีรูปแบบเดียวกันภายในแอปพลิเคชันที่ใช้ PHP ได้อย่างรวดเร็ว

  • GroupDocs.Merger Cloud for cURL
  • GroupDocs.Merger Cloud SDK for .NET
  • GroupDocs.Merger Cloud SDK for Java
  • GroupDocs.Merger Cloud SDK for Python
  • GroupDocs.Merger Cloud SDK for Ruby
  • GroupDocs.Merger Cloud SDK for Node.js
  • GroupDocs.Merger Cloud SDK for Android
เริ่มทดลองใช้งานฟรี

GroupDocs.Merger Cloud SDK สำหรับ PHP เป็นโซลูชันเชิงโปรแกรมที่รวมเอกสารหลายฉบับที่มีรูปแบบเดียวกันเข้าเป็นหนึ่งเดียวกันได้อย่างราบรื่น ช่วยให้รวมเอกสารเหล่านี้ทีละหน้าหรือเลือกระหว่างช่วงหน้าก็ได้ Cloud SDK รองรับการดำเนินการเอกสารที่มีประโยชน์มากมายเพื่อแยกเอกสารหนึ่งฉบับออกเป็นหลายฉบับ และสร้างภาพแสดงหน้าเอกสารในรูปแบบ PNG, JPG และ BMP เพื่อการวินิจฉัยโครงสร้างและเนื้อหาของเอกสารภายในเอกสารได้ดีขึ้น SDK สำหรับการรวมและแยกเอกสารยังสามารถดำเนินการรวมและแยกหน้าเอกสารที่มีประโยชน์มากมายได้ ดังนั้นคุณจึงสามารถย้าย ลบ หมุน สลับ แยก หรือเปลี่ยนทิศทางของหน้าเอกสารได้ พร้อมรองรับการดึงข้อมูลเอกสารและการจัดการเอกสารที่ป้องกันด้วยรหัสผ่านเพิ่มเติม GroupDocs.Merger Cloud SDK สำหรับ PHP ถูกสร้างขึ้นเป็นเลเยอร์บน GroupDocs.Merger Cloud REST API ซึ่งสามารถใช้กับภาษาหรือแพลตฟอร์มการพัฒนาใดๆ ก็ได้ที่สามารถเรียกใช้ REST API ได้

ฟีเจอร์ REST API สำหรับการผสานเอกสาร

รวมหน้า สไลด์ หรือสเปรดชีตหลาย ๆ หน้าไว้ในเอกสารเดียว

สลับตำแหน่งของสองหน้า สไลด์ หรือแผ่นงานภายในเอกสาร

หมุนหน้าโดยตั้งมุมการหมุน เช่น 90, 180 หรือ 270 องศา

แบ่งเอกสารใดๆ ออกเป็นไฟล์ที่เล็กลง

ลบหน้าใดหน้าหนึ่งหรือชุดหน้าเฉพาะออก

เปลี่ยนทิศทางหน้า

จัดเรียงหน้า สไลด์ หรือไดอะแกรมใหม่

ตั้งค่า รีเซ็ต และลบรหัสผ่าน

ดึงรายการรูปแบบไฟล์ที่รองรับ

รวมหลายเพจเข้าด้วยกัน - PHP

  //Get your App SID and App Key at https://dashboard.groupdocs.cloud (free registration is required).
  class JoinMultipleDocuments {
    public static function Run() {
    
      $documentApi = CommonUtils::GetDocumentApiInstance();
    
      $fileInfo1 = new Model\FileInfo();
      $fileInfo1->setFilePath("WordProcessing/four-pages.docx");         
      $item1 = new Model\JoinItem();        
      $item1->setFileInfo($fileInfo1);

      $fileInfo2 = new Model\FileInfo();
      $fileInfo2->setFilePath("WordProcessing/one-page.docx");          
      $item2 = new Model\JoinItem();
      $item2->setFileInfo($fileInfo2);                
    
      $options = new Model\JoinOptions();
      $options->setJoinItems([$item1, $item2]);
      $options->setOutputPath("Output/joined.docx");

      $request = new Requests\joinRequest($options);       
      $response = $documentApi->join($request);
    
      echo "Output file path: " . $response->getPath();    
      echo "\n";                        
    }
  }		
      ```

Support and Learning Resources

GroupDocs.Merger Cloud ยังเสนอ SDK สำหรับการผสานเอกสารรายบุคคลสำหรับภาษาอื่นๆ อีกด้วย ดังต่อไปนี้:

  แบบไทย